In Monroe, common issues include suspension wear from our variable terrain and potholed roads, and cooling system failures exacerbated by summer heat and winter cold cycles. Electrical issues with window regulators and battery drain are also frequent, often requiring specialized BMW diagnostic equipment.
Look for shops that are BMW-specific or European-specialist, and verify they use factory-level diagnostic tools like ISTA. Check for certifications (ASE, BMW-specific training) and read local reviews on platforms like Google or Nextdoor that mention Monroe-area experiences with long-term customer relationships.
You should seek a specialist for any check engine light diagnosis, complex electrical faults, or advanced drivetrain work (e.g., xDrive all-wheel-drive service). Monroe's hills and weather demand precise calibration of these systems, which general shops often lack the proprietary software and training for.
In Monroe, independent specialists typically charge 20-40% less than the dealership for labor. For example, a common brake job may range from $400-$800, while a cooling system overhaul might be $1,200-$2,000, depending on the model, with parts costs being a significant factor.
